FBN1 TB5 domain variants in acromelic dysplasia: multisystem manifestations, genotype-phenotype correlations, and partial responses to growth hormone therapy.

Background: Acromelic dysplasias, including acromicric dysplasia (AD) and geleophysic dysplasia type 2 (GD2), are ultrarare disorders caused by FBN1 variants in the transforming growth factor-β-binding protein-like domain 5 (TB5). These conditions are characterized by severe short stature and variable multisystem involvement, but genotype-phenotype correlations and treatment responses remain incompletely defined....
